1SFL447263R1122 ABB: A 4-pole Contactor suitable for Railway applications such as Motor starting, Isolation, By-pass and Distribution application up to max 690 V. Operated with wide control voltage range 24-60 V, 50 and 60 Hz, 20-60 V DC

Yes. The AF140B-40-22-11 supports 50 Hz/60 Hz operation at 24–60 V AC and a DC option of 20–60 V. This wide coil range enables seamless integration with diverse control systems and automation platforms, reducing the need for custom converters or adapters.
The device features four main normally-open (NO) contacts and two auxiliary normally-open (NO) plus two auxiliary normally-closed (NC) contacts. This configuration provides robust switching for multi-line motor control and control-circuit interlocks while keeping wiring footprint compact.
This model carries CE and UL/cULus listings and UKCA marking, with additional support for EAC, KC, and CCC in various regions. These certifications help ensure compliance for rail and industrial deployments, facilitating global supply and procurement workflows.
The contactor core measures 120 mm in width, 128 mm in depth, and 150 mm in height, with a net weight of 2.05 kg. Terminal type for main circuit is bars, aiding straightforward wiring and stable high-current connections in compact control panels.
For AC-3 operation, the contactor provides up to 140 A at voltages such as 415–440 V or 380–400 V. For DC-3, currents up to 160 A are supported under various voltage configurations. These ratings suit medium-power motors and contactor assemblies in rail and industrial automation applications.
